ABERYSTWYTH LIQUID DIGESTED SLUDGE
Liquid effluents can be applied to arable or grassland fields. It is normal to inject the material below the surface for grassland. The crop nutrients are rapidly incorporated into the soil and can be taken up by crops almost immediately. Much of the Nitrogen in this material however, is held in the organic fraction of the effluent and will release slowly to the crop over a period of months. Because it is bound up in the organic matter, it does not easily leach out of the soil, and can continue to feed the crop throughout the growing cycle.
Normal applications are in the region of
80 tonnes per hectare (32 tonnes per acre) At these rates the soil will
receive a total of 200 units per acre of Nitrogen, 182 units of
Phosphate and 18 units of Potash.
Note that the table shows PHOSPHORUS as 99.1 kgs. To convert this to PHOSPHATE, multiply by 2.291. POTASSIUM is converted to POTASH by multiplying by 1.205. |
